HMU8-9570 Hybrid Energy Controller is used for micro grid management system composed of
solar energy, wind energy, energy storage battery and genset, which can monitor data via RS485 port. It
can also control the start and stop of gensets in system according to load or storage battery SOC, and
control output power by setting genset voltage, frequency center point and droop percentage. In
addition, it has economy and power maintaining running modes.
HMU8-9570 Hybrid Energy Controller applies 8-inch 800*600 resolution capacitive touch screen
with Chinese and English display. It is simple to operate and reliable to run.
HUM8-9570 hybrid energy controller can be used for data monitoring and control of inverter,
converter and genset, which is suitable for micro grid hybrid energy system composed of photovoltaic,
storage energy and genset, also for hybrid energy system composed of storage energy and genset.

PCS supplies power for load in VSG (Virtual Synchronous Genset) mode. When storage loading
power is greater than start power of scheduled genset or battery pack SOC is lower than cutoff
discharge SOC, genset will start. If genset and storage battery pack share the load, when load power is
lower than allowed storage charge power, genset will charge the battery pack with constant voltage and
frequency of storage rated charge power. When battery pack SOC is greater than cutoff charge SOC,
genset will not charge for battery pack, genset and storage battery pack share the load (NOTE: Converter
droop and genset droop should be set as same). When load power is lower than stop power of scheduled
genset, genset will stop.

ECONOMY MODE
If solar energy and storage energy supply power for load, when storage power is greater than
start power of scheduled genset or battery pack SOC is lower than cutoff discharge SOC,
genset will start. If PV outputs with max power, converter and genset share left load, when
load power is lower than PV output power, PV output power is limited, genset reverse power is
prevented and storage battery pack overcharge is prohibited. The solar energy takes load first,
only supplies power for storage battery pack when solar energy is sufficient. When load power
is lower than stop power of scheduled genset and battery pack SOC is greater than cutoff
charge SOC, genset will stop.
